Could me engine timing be inaccurate
Thanks for looking to help me out. I really appreciate it. I have a crate blueprint 350 https://blueprintengines.com/product...ed-front-drive
I'm worried I have not done the timing process correctly. 1. I pulled all the plugs and put a paper towel ball in plug hole 1. 2. I turned the engine with a socket wrench and after a few turns the ball shot out. 3. I saw on the harmonic balancer this was top dead zero per the marking. 4. I dropped the distributer and as it lowered it turned ~50 degrees clockwise. I was worried this was too much of a rotation because I have never done this before. 5. I raised the distributer, rotated it ~55 degrees counter clockwise. I lowered the distributor in the exact same degree orientation I have seen in a dozen mechanic videos and it rotated itself ~55 degrees clockwise again just like last time. 6. I started the engine. At ~2500 RPM with my timing light I rotated the distribuer to show 36 degrees advanced on the harmonic balancer which is the value in my documentation. Is there anyway possible that my engine is not actually at 36 degrees advanced? |

As you lowered the distributor into position, the rotor rotated a bit because the gears on the shaft are spiral cut.. This rotation is normal.. If the vacuum canister on the distributor is in a "comfortable" position after the timing is set, you're good to go.. Wanna see something that will fascinate and puzzle you a little more?? Re: Could me engine timing be inaccurate
Usually the initial is with the vacuum disconnected.
BTW, I'm more a fan of experimenting with timing. The specs are just suggestions. As long as you can hear the knock (pinging, marbles in the coffee can, or whatever it sounds like to you), I'd advance the timing and see how it runs. If you have loud exhausts then stick to the specs. I had a Chevy S-10 pickup through the 1980s and 1990s didn't own a timing light. I just adjusted timing to get very light knock at wide open throttle. It ran much better when advanced from the factory/dealer tune-up settings. Set timing as said then double check advance at 3500-4000 rpm. This guarantees that the distributer springs let all that timing in. SbC usually like 29-36 degrees total timing not including vac advance. I set to 36 degrees at high rpm then test drive and back it down from there. Many aftermarket distributors will have base timing at idle around 16 or 17 degrees. Honestly you don't need a tach. Set over all timing at a high rpm then note what it is at idle for future reference
This is the only way to do it unless you are recurving the distributer. The curve is dependent on the distributer wieghts and springs and on some distributors, the bushings |
